Saudi Gazette report
ROME — Saudi Minister of Justice Walid Al-Samaani met with his Italian counterpart Carlo Nordio in Rome during an official visit to Italy.
The ministers discussed enhancing judicial cooperation and exchanging expertise in legislation and judicial systems, aiming to improve the efficiency of justice systems in both countries.
Al-Samaani highlighted the ongoing reforms within the Saudi justice system, including the implementation of a preventive justice framework, strengthening legal safeguards, and enhancing transparency through audio and video documentation of court hearings.
During the meeting, the ministers sign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) to strengthen cooperation in judicial systems and develop the professional competencies of judges and judicial sector employees, as well as to foster greater integration and expertise exchange between the two countries.
